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Add automated release process #43

Merged
merged 4 commits into from
Jun 24, 2024
Merged

Add automated release process #43

merged 4 commits into from
Jun 24, 2024

Conversation

AlecRosenbaum
Copy link
Contributor

@AlecRosenbaum AlecRosenbaum commented Jun 24, 2024

Can be manually dispatched on master, and uploads the current version to pypi.

This PR also bumps the version to 0.2.4 and I'll intend to cut a release using it.

I believe I have to merge this before I can test it, since the action can't be dispatched yet. I'll likely have to follow up with fixes.

Base automatically changed from gh-actions to master June 24, 2024 18:56
Copy link
Member

@thomasst thomasst left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Don't see anything apparent that would be wrong.

@AlecRosenbaum
Copy link
Contributor Author

Once it's merged I think I'll be able to run it on a test branch (that targets testpypi), then I'll iterate there until everything works correctly.

@AlecRosenbaum AlecRosenbaum merged commit 5e1a673 into master Jun 24, 2024
16 checks passed
@AlecRosenbaum AlecRosenbaum deleted the auto-release branch June 24, 2024 19:26
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

2 participants